Default Buying Navigation system questions

I'm considering buying a 370 but most of them don't come with the Navigation system. I've seen them and I like them in the cars that have them. Is it a hard thing to find and have added to the car and how much is the Nissan system new or used.

Buy a Touring model with it already installed or an aftermarket. It would be multiple thousands of dollars to add the Nissan Navi to a Z that didn't come with it pre-installed.

Current estimate is 2k+ just alone for parts, the navigation/audio system also integrates into the A/C system which requires different controls.
